I used to play a HB-21 in College but decided that Tuba performance wasn't going to pay my bills, so i took a slight career turn, sold my Hirsbrunner, and have been happily working in music ever since.
anyhow - i've been getting the itch to play again, and really want to buy a vintage horn - specifically a York.
In researching this, i've learned that some of the horns cut to CC are problematic - i guess original CC 44 yorks are pretty rare?
BTW - i'm only interested in original GrandRapids Yorks - not the later stuff -
any known available horns? I am considering the Rusk Cut from Baltimore Brass, as well as another Dillon Cut in NYC - both of which are conversions using King valves, so its not really clear just how much is original York.
any advice? available horns? etc.
